The real Spiral Eye needles are terrific!! The needles are made in the U.S. also. They have no burrs or rough spots either.
The knock-off ones have been known to break thread often, and are not as good of quality. Made elsewhere also.

I say support the gal here in the U.S., as her products are great! :)

I think the spiral eye ones could be used to do something like sewing a binding, appliqueing, etc. The self threading needles are used just to tuck in loose threads from FMQ and machine quilting.
